Reliance Jio’s IPO Set for 2025: Ambani Targets Major Telecom Market Debut

Reliance Jio Eyes Indian Stock Market Listing Amid Strong Growth and Investor Interest

Reliance Jio, the telecommunications giant led by Mukesh Ambani, is preparing to debut on the Indian stock market with an Initial Public Offering (IPO) anticipated in 2025, according to a recent report by Reuters. Citing sources familiar with the matter, the report indicates that Jio, currently valued by analysts at over USD 100 billion, has reached a phase of steady revenue generation and business stability as India’s leading telecom operator, making it a prime candidate for a stock market entry.

This IPO aligns with Ambani’s earlier hints from 2019 about listing both Jio and Reliance Retail within a five-year timeframe. While Reliance Retail’s IPO has been postponed, Jio’s entry into the public market has been prioritized, with the retail unit’s listing expected to occur only after 2025. According to Jefferies’ analysis in July, Jio’s IPO valuation could reach an estimated USD 112 billion, underscoring the brand’s robust position within India’s competitive telecom sector.

The report suggests that the IPO could capitalize on India’s thriving stock market, where multiple companies have recently launched successful public offerings. An IPO offers companies the chance to raise equity capital by selling shares to public investors, often leading to significant market gains. While Reliance Industries has yet to comment on the matter, investors are keenly watching for what may become one of India’s largest and most awaited IPOs in recent years.
